



Aviation officials in Dubai announced that "limited" flights of Dubai International Airport would resume on Monday evening, with a small number of flights allowed to operate from the region's two main hubs – Dubai International and Dubai World Central.
Due to the crises in the Middle East, more than 4,000 flights a day have been cancelled across the region, with hundreds of thousands of passengers affected. The Dubai-based airline Emirates says it will accommodate customers with earlier bookings on these flights as a priority, and will contact passengers directly.
